Recently I've been teaching a student of mine in drawing. It's been a joy to teach him and in some ways it's made me a better artist. I've encouraged him to keep a small sketchbook in the car in case he finds himself with some down time parked somewhere. I also told him to keep one on his person, in case he finds himself standing in line. Practicing everyday or as often as he can is great but I told him to find something he likes to draw, like a fictional made-up character. By drawing something he loves he'll get better at applying the traits of that character to another made up one. The more fired up one is about drawing, the better the sketches will turn out. Passion makes a big difference and that's...one to grow on.
